Output 66413314705ae1df74170eb7bd3199f8247c73151d98f971a4a3be156145d360:0

value
40543386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86bd4f8d8f3647e219738395f356ddec89e685de OP_EQUAL
address
3DyTFnpW7gMYPX75Tb1CopUP28x4RsaF3e
transaction
66413314705ae1df74170eb7bd3199f8247c73151d98f971a4a3be156145d360
spent
true